Our spring concert always marks a moment of reflection and joy, but this year, more so than most. Tonight, we consider “Through Lines”: that which connects, weaves, maintains, and transforms.

In considering the past we celebrate the legacy of longtime Director of Bands Barry Spanier, who retired after 21 years at the conclusion of a historic football season that culminated in a College Football Playoff appearance.

As we look upon the present, Tulane Bands is premiering its first-ever commissioned wind band work, composed by Dr. James David. This artistic feat is made possible through the generosity of alumna Gillian Duncan and Michael Belknap, and serves as a testament to the growth, fortitude, and musicianship of our talented musicians who continue to raise the bar, year after year.

And to the future: we are committed to the growth and vitality of Tulane Bands— a cornerstone of Tulane, uniting the artistic, the social, the athletic, and the academic.
